Home
last modified time | relevance | path

Searched refs:reg_space (Results 1 – 13 of 13) sorted by relevance

/Linux-v4.19/drivers/net/ethernet/stmicro/stmmac/
Ddwmac4_dma.c142 u32 *reg_space) in _dwmac4_dump_dma_regs() argument
144 reg_space[DMA_CHAN_CONTROL(channel) / 4] = in _dwmac4_dump_dma_regs()
146 reg_space[DMA_CHAN_TX_CONTROL(channel) / 4] = in _dwmac4_dump_dma_regs()
148 reg_space[DMA_CHAN_RX_CONTROL(channel) / 4] = in _dwmac4_dump_dma_regs()
150 reg_space[DMA_CHAN_TX_BASE_ADDR(channel) / 4] = in _dwmac4_dump_dma_regs()
152 reg_space[DMA_CHAN_RX_BASE_ADDR(channel) / 4] = in _dwmac4_dump_dma_regs()
154 reg_space[DMA_CHAN_TX_END_ADDR(channel) / 4] = in _dwmac4_dump_dma_regs()
156 reg_space[DMA_CHAN_RX_END_ADDR(channel) / 4] = in _dwmac4_dump_dma_regs()
158 reg_space[DMA_CHAN_TX_RING_LEN(channel) / 4] = in _dwmac4_dump_dma_regs()
160 reg_space[DMA_CHAN_RX_RING_LEN(channel) / 4] = in _dwmac4_dump_dma_regs()
[all …]
Ddwmac100_core.c55 static void dwmac100_dump_mac_regs(struct mac_device_info *hw, u32 *reg_space) in dwmac100_dump_mac_regs() argument
59 reg_space[MAC_CONTROL / 4] = readl(ioaddr + MAC_CONTROL); in dwmac100_dump_mac_regs()
60 reg_space[MAC_ADDR_HIGH / 4] = readl(ioaddr + MAC_ADDR_HIGH); in dwmac100_dump_mac_regs()
61 reg_space[MAC_ADDR_LOW / 4] = readl(ioaddr + MAC_ADDR_LOW); in dwmac100_dump_mac_regs()
62 reg_space[MAC_HASH_HIGH / 4] = readl(ioaddr + MAC_HASH_HIGH); in dwmac100_dump_mac_regs()
63 reg_space[MAC_HASH_LOW / 4] = readl(ioaddr + MAC_HASH_LOW); in dwmac100_dump_mac_regs()
64 reg_space[MAC_FLOW_CTRL / 4] = readl(ioaddr + MAC_FLOW_CTRL); in dwmac100_dump_mac_regs()
65 reg_space[MAC_VLAN1 / 4] = readl(ioaddr + MAC_VLAN1); in dwmac100_dump_mac_regs()
66 reg_space[MAC_VLAN2 / 4] = readl(ioaddr + MAC_VLAN2); in dwmac100_dump_mac_regs()
Ddwmac100_dma.c78 static void dwmac100_dump_dma_regs(void __iomem *ioaddr, u32 *reg_space) in dwmac100_dump_dma_regs() argument
83 reg_space[DMA_BUS_MODE / 4 + i] = in dwmac100_dump_dma_regs()
86 reg_space[DMA_CUR_TX_BUF_ADDR / 4] = in dwmac100_dump_dma_regs()
88 reg_space[DMA_CUR_RX_BUF_ADDR / 4] = in dwmac100_dump_dma_regs()
Dstmmac_ethtool.c433 u32 *reg_space = (u32 *) space; in stmmac_ethtool_gregs() local
437 memset(reg_space, 0x0, REG_SPACE_SIZE); in stmmac_ethtool_gregs()
439 stmmac_dump_mac_regs(priv, priv->hw, reg_space); in stmmac_ethtool_gregs()
440 stmmac_dump_dma_regs(priv, priv->ioaddr, reg_space); in stmmac_ethtool_gregs()
442 memcpy(&reg_space[ETHTOOL_DMA_OFFSET], &reg_space[DMA_BUS_MODE / 4], in stmmac_ethtool_gregs()
Ddwmac1000_dma.c221 static void dwmac1000_dump_dma_regs(void __iomem *ioaddr, u32 *reg_space) in dwmac1000_dump_dma_regs() argument
227 reg_space[DMA_BUS_MODE / 4 + i] = in dwmac1000_dump_dma_regs()
Ddwmac-sun8i.c305 static void sun8i_dwmac_dump_regs(void __iomem *ioaddr, u32 *reg_space) in sun8i_dwmac_dump_regs() argument
312 reg_space[i / 4] = readl(ioaddr + i); in sun8i_dwmac_dump_regs()
321 u32 *reg_space) in sun8i_dwmac_dump_mac_regs() argument
329 reg_space[i / 4] = readl(ioaddr + i); in sun8i_dwmac_dump_mac_regs()
Ddwmac1000_core.c106 static void dwmac1000_dump_regs(struct mac_device_info *hw, u32 *reg_space) in dwmac1000_dump_regs() argument
112 reg_space[i] = readl(ioaddr + i * 4); in dwmac1000_dump_regs()
Ddwmac4_core.c273 static void dwmac4_dump_regs(struct mac_device_info *hw, u32 *reg_space) in dwmac4_dump_regs() argument
279 reg_space[i] = readl(ioaddr + i * 4); in dwmac4_dump_regs()
Dhwif.h159 void (*dump_regs)(void __iomem *ioaddr, u32 *reg_space);
283 void (*dump_regs)(struct mac_device_info *hw, u32 *reg_space);
/Linux-v4.19/drivers/net/ethernet/samsung/sxgbe/
Dsxgbe_ethtool.c445 u32 *reg_space = (u32 *)space; in sxgbe_get_regs() local
450 memset(reg_space, 0x0, REG_SPACE_SIZE); in sxgbe_get_regs()
455 reg_space[reg_ix] = readl(ioaddr + reg_offset); in sxgbe_get_regs()
462 reg_space[reg_ix] = readl(ioaddr + reg_offset); in sxgbe_get_regs()
469 reg_space[reg_ix] = readl(ioaddr + reg_offset); in sxgbe_get_regs()
/Linux-v4.19/drivers/gpu/drm/hisilicon/kirin/
Dkirin_drm_ade.c395 u32 reg_ctrl, reg_addr, reg_size, reg_stride, reg_space, reg_en; in ade_rdma_dump_regs() local
402 reg_space = RD_CH_SPACE(ch); in ade_rdma_dump_regs()
415 val = readl(base + reg_space); in ade_rdma_dump_regs()
627 u32 reg_ctrl, reg_addr, reg_size, reg_stride, reg_space, reg_en; in ade_rdma_set() local
642 reg_space = RD_CH_SPACE(ch); in ade_rdma_set()
652 writel(in_h * stride, base + reg_space); in ade_rdma_set()
/Linux-v4.19/drivers/net/ethernet/neterion/vxge/
Dvxge-ethtool.c133 u64 *reg_space = (u64 *)space; in vxge_ethtool_gregs() local
152 *reg_space++ = reg; in vxge_ethtool_gregs()
/Linux-v4.19/drivers/net/ethernet/neterion/
Ds2io.c5366 u8 *reg_space = (u8 *)space; in s2io_ethtool_gregs() local
5374 memcpy((reg_space + i), &reg, 8); in s2io_ethtool_gregs()